Joseph Magagnoli wrote:
> I am trying to estimate a model of third party intervention into civil war.  
> The data is panel data structure.  The unit of analysis
> is civil war year.  For each civil war year my dependent variable is coded 
> 0=no intervention and 1=intervention.  I want to use a
> lagged dependent variable as an independent variable and i am including other 
> variables such as type of war conventional=0,1 dummy
> irregular 0,1 dummy,,, other dummy variables such as cold war period, and 
> other variables such as state strength .   Some of my independent variables 
> are time invariant or slow moving.   Because i want to include lagged 
> dependent variable rules out a fixed effect,
> therefore I was thinking of using random effects.    Any suggestion on how to 
> model this?

>  You haven't given us nearly enough information to go on.
> If you're talking about something like a state-space model with
> a binary response, I would probably say your best bet is
> a Bayesian approach, prob. via JAGS/R2jags or WinBUGS/R2WinBUGS.
> (A lot) more context will give a higher probability of a useful
> answer.
